McLaren Boston
Dealer Description
The goal of McLaren Boston is to provide discerning customers with a personalized buying experience, where expectations are exceeded and the highest level of customer service provided. Each hand-crafted McLaren pioneers new technology, breaks industry norms, and pushes the envelope in speed, performance and dynamic engineering. We at McLaren Boston are inspired by this every day.
22 Pond St , Norwell, MA, 02061
View on Google MapsContact the Dealer
Dealer Review